Key Takeaways China is reshaping its rare earth export controls. Among 17 rare earth elements (REEs), China has imposed export controls on seven heavier ones (Dy, Tb, Sm, Gd, Lu, Sc, Y) and their processed products, mostly magnets. REEs and magnets, dominated by China. According to WoodMac, Chinese companies control 65%/88% of global mined/refined mid to heavy rare earths supply and >90% of downstream NdFeB Permanent magnet supply in 2025.
